I put my 128 mb SanDisk flashcard into a kiosk at Kinko's in order to print out some photos. The kiosk read the chip, started displaying the photos then an error came up and the pic's disappeared. After putting the chip back in the camera it reads "memory card error". I've tried it several times with the same error message. Are my pic's gone? Is the chip now garbage? What gives?

Any advice would be greatly appreciated. Thanks in advance.
